This time it is the Riad Alegria, situated by Bahia Palace, close to Jamaa El Fnaa and many key sights, and I am headed there now, keen to see what new sumptuous surprises lay in store. For my Spanish partner it already bodes well, as ‘Alegria’ in his language, means Joy...
We arrive in the afternoon and gratefully duck into the cool interior where we are greeted with friendly smiles and a peaceful, traditional inner courtyard with water fountain, surrounded by orange trees. The décor is a tasteful blend of classic Moroccan style and modern chic which maintains a light, elegant air throughout. The shades of red and white along with earthy tones, feel both fresh and cosy. Our bedroom is exactly this. Bright, spacious and sumptuous with its vast bed and bathroom with walk-in shower and his'n'hers sinks. We have a pretty seating area and large flat screen television as well as air conditioning and free Wi-Fi, reminding us that this is indeed a luxury hotel with the highest standards of facilities.
